American Airlines grounds all flights nationwide on 'technical issue'

Investing.com — American Airlines shares dropped more than 3.8% premarket Tuesday after the United States Federal Aviation Administration announced that the carrier has grounded all flights nationwide.

The stock is currently trading around the $16.60 per share mark.

American Airlines (NASDAQ:AAL) issued a statement: "Our teams are working to resolve the issue as quickly as possible, and we apologize to our customers for the inconvenience."

Responding to a customer on the social media platform X (formerly Twitter), the airline mentioned they are "currently experiencing a technical issue with all American Airlines flights." They emphasized: "Your safety is our utmost priority; once this is rectified, we'll have you safely on your way to your destination."

In reply to another customer, the airline stated: "An estimated timeframe has not been provided, but they're trying to fix it in the shortest possible time."
